Women and children often face serious legal issues such as domestic abuse, neglect, maintenance disputes, and violations of child rights. In many situations, victims are unaware of their legal protections and the proper legal remedies available under Indian law.

Areas of Legal Guidance
Domestic Abuse Remedies
Advisory support regarding legal remedies available under the Protection of Women from Domestic Violence Act, including protection orders and other legal reliefs.
Women’s Protection Laws
Guidance regarding various legal provisions designed to protect women from harassment, abuse, and exploitation.
Child Rights & Welfare
Advisory support related to child welfare issues, guardianship concerns, and protection of children’s legal rights.
Maintenance Guidance
Legal guidance regarding maintenance rights under Section 144 of the Bharatiya Nagarik Suraksha Sanhita (BNSS), 2023 (corresponding to former Section 125 CrPC).
POCSO Act Guidance
Basic legal guidance related to the Protection of Children from Sexual Offences (POCSO) Act and procedures for reporting child abuse.
